I was scared witless, too. I had to circle the block a few times but didn't go in.
Finally, I decided I wanted to get sober more than I wanted to drink and went in.
Nobody seemed to notice me as being new. When the speaker asked if it was anyone's first meeting I was too chicken to raise my hand.

It took me about five different meetings before I said anything, but I sure did absorb a lot of wisdom.
I think it's great you're going. You have nothing to fear. And everything to gain.
